Thread (6 messages) 6 messages, 4 authors, 2014-09-30

[PATCH v5 2/3] net: Add Keystone NetCP ethernet driver

From: geert@linux-m68k.org (Geert Uytterhoeven)
Date: 2014-09-30 13:28:27
Also in: linux-devicetree, lkml, netdev

On Tue, Sep 30, 2014 at 3:09 PM, David Laight [off-list ref] wrote:
quoted
quoted
+static inline int gbe_phy_link_status(struct gbe_slave *slave)
+{
+   if (!slave->phy)
+           return 1;
+
+   if (slave->phy->link)
+           return 1;
+
+   return 0;
+}
Please use 'bool' as the return type and return 'true' or 'false'.
That function body could also be just:
        return !slave->phy && slave->phy->link;
which might be more readable if directly coded.
return !slave->phy || slave->phy->link;

Gr{oetje,eeting}s,

                        Geert

--
Geert Uytterhoeven -- There's lots of Linux beyond ia32 -- geert at linux-m68k.org

In personal conversations with technical people, I call myself a hacker. But
when I'm talking to journalists I just say "programmer" or something like that.
                                -- Linus Torvalds
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help